CrowdStrike offers the Falcon Endpoint Protection suite, an antivirus and endpoint protection system emphasizing threat detection, machine learning malware detection, and signature free updating. Additionally the available Falcon Spotlight module delivers vulnerability assessment with no performance impact, no additional agents, hardware, scheduled scans, firewall exceptions or admin credentials.

Rapid7 offers InsightConnect, a SOAR solution that integrates with existing solutions to orchestrate vulnerability management processes from notification to remediation, so users can ensure critical issues are being addressed with every security advisory that comes in—while leaving human decision points where most critical. Automate actions to scan, find patches, and verify remediation.N/A

Cons
CrowdStrike
  • Sometimes updates to sensor versions fail, which requires manual intervention by internal staff members
  • The variety of different administrative privilege levels is vast and sometimes confusing
  • Proactive notifications confirming the health of the environment would be great instead of just reporting on potential issues
Read full review
Rapid7
  • It would be great if Rapid7 InsightConnect could be configured based on pre determined specifications when installing the agent.
  • We've noticed that at times, there are certain network parameters needed in order for Rapid7 to collect and report data efficiently.
  • Sometimes there are issues with the discovery scan in Rapid7 making it hard to configure in the beginning.

Support Rating
CrowdStrike
Support is generally pretty fast and gets right to the issue. We haven't had to use them much, fortunately, but the issues and questions we've had are usually answered quickly. The customer success manager/account manager you're assigned will also follow up with you on a regular cadence to ensure you're getting the most out of the subscription. There's not a whole lot of room to improve, other than the general confusion about what is/what is not covered in custom packages you're subscribed to. The initial purchase took much longer because of a package name changes and realignments of different modules into those packages.
